ROB Camra left this review about Old Street Tavern
Looks like this may have moved on again since the last review. You enter into a small seating area, the bar is up a couple of steps to your right where there's some more seating. Upstairs is another seating area which is also used as a small function room and for live music. Three handpumps on the bar with Ludlow and Hobsons on two of the pumps and rather unusully for round here, Oakham Citra on the third pump. I had a pint of the Ludlow and Ms CAMRA a half of the citra. Both were in very good nick. Plenty of banter going on amongst some of the most well spoken people I've ever come acrooss in a micropub. Judging by the conversation topics they're not really posh, they just sound it. We'll call back next time we're in Ludlow.

Real Ale Ray left this review about Artisan Ales (Old Tap Room)
The layout has changed slightly with a tiny bar downstairs, plus some seating and the owner's wife has the upstairs section for her vintage clothes and oddments, plus you can still use the upstairs for extra seating. This micro was quite retro with a 60's style theme, with brightly coloured walls and bright coloured chairs. The owner was very friendly and had two ales on stillage from Three Tuns Brewery, which were Three Tuns Best Bitter and Rantipole pale ale. Out of the two I thought the Best Bitter was excellent.
